FENDER AMERICAN PROFESSIONAL CLASSIC MUSTANG BASS 2025

We are happy to offer for sale this Fender Mustang Bass in pristine condition. Details as follows:

Ā 

  • Year of manufacture: 2025
  • Country of origin: USA (Corona, CA)
  • SerialĀ number:Ā US25099060
  • BodyĀ Material: Alder
  • Weight: 7.55 lbs
  • BodyĀ Finish: Gloss Urethane
  • BodyĀ Shape: MustangĀ® Bass
  • NeckĀ Material: Maple
  • NeckĀ Finish: Satin Urethane (back), Gloss Urethane (headstock face)
  • NeckĀ Shape: Modern "C"
  • ScaleĀ Length: 30" (762 mm)
  • FingerboardĀ Material: Rosewood
  • FingerboardĀ Radius: 9.5" (241 mm)
  • NumberĀ ofĀ Frets: 19
  • FretĀ Size: Medium Jumbo
  • NutĀ Material: Synthetic Bone
  • NutĀ Width: 41mm
  • Pickup: Fender Coastlineā„¢ '70s Split-Coil MustangĀ® Bass
  • Controls: Master Volume, Master Tone (with Greasebucketā„¢ Tone Circuit)
  • Bridge: 4-Saddle MustangĀ® Bass Strings-Through-Body
  • HardwareĀ Finish: Nickel/Chrome
  • TuningĀ Machines: Vintage-Style "Lollipop"
  • Pickguard: 3-Ply Black/White/Black
  • Condition: 10/10
  • Case: Gig bag included

Ā 

Comments:

This Fender American Professional Classic Mustang Bass is part of a series launched in 2025 that serves as the entry point for Fender’s prestigious USA-made lineup, specifically designed to bridge the gap between vintage 1970s aesthetics and modern high-performance playability. This specific model in 3-Tone Sunburst draws heavily from 1970s Mustang Bass design, most notably featuring period-correct "Lollipop" tuners, which were originally only used by Fender for a brief window between 1965 and 1968 on other bass models. It maintains the classic 30-inch short scale length. This shorter scale results in lower string tension and narrower fret spacing, making it a popular choice for guitarists transitioning to bass or players who prefer a more compact instrument. While it looks vintage, it includes modern upgrades like a satin-finished neck for faster playability and the Greasebucket Tone System, which allows you to roll off high frequencies without adding unwanted bass "mudā€.
